Sail with us as
we travel between the islands in the Caribbean on our way over more than 600
nautical miles between The Virgin Islands and Grenada.
We have four
inter-island cruises from which to choose, each with numerous options for
overnight visits: Sint Maarten to Antigua; Antigua to Martinique; Martinique
to St. Vincent; St. Vincent through the Grenadines to Grenada.
You will arrive
at one location and depart another. Many inter-island flights occur on Liat or WinAir
Airlines.
